- How to kill green algae in saltwater aquarium forever using hydrogen peroxide. i tried phosphate rx, snail, clean up crews, water changes and nothing worked to remove my crazy green hair algae outbreak last year except hydrogen peroxide.

the hydrogen peroxide I have is 29% so what do you recommend for 150 gal ?
I would cut it in half so if i'm doing 1ml per 10 gallons with 12%, you would do 1ml with a syringe in the water for every 20 gallons. if you go over by a ml or 2 it's ok. so you would do 8mls. my tank was so bad the green hair algae was long. i turned off all power heads and pumps and dosed direct to the hair algae. after 10 minutes i turned the pumps back on. after 2 weeks i never had hair algae again. the corals didn't like it too much but they were fine after a week.

It works on algae that's for Sure. Keep in mind, certain corals don't like this solution. In my experience softies were most effected. Most corals close for days in the process. However after recovery, they look better than ever. I'm assuming their getting a facelift during the treatment (debridement).
